Full Job Description

Reporting to our Visitor Attraction Exhibits Manager, our Team Leader's primary responsibility will be to ensure the smooth and efficient day-to-day running of the exhibitions across the estate. You'll utilise both your people skills as well as your love for our exhibits as a huge focus will be on the guest experience, ensuring our guests enjoy their time with us from arrival through to departure. The role will also involve leading a team of around 25 hosts across 3 exhibits spread out across the Estate. This will involve assisting with scheduling, inputting absences and approving holidays - ensuring there is enough cover across all exhibits throughout the year. You'll develop a strong knowledge of the exhibits, their workings and their history - sharing your knowledge with both team members and guests. You'll also be trained in exhibition curatorial duty of care and guide your team in proper care for the exhibits., Assist the VA Exhibitions Manager with the scheduling of Hosts to ensure adequate staffing levels across the exhibits. Supporting the VA Exhibit Manager in the ongoing training and development of VA Exhibit Hosts. Audit and ordering of operating supplies in a timely manner. Ensuring visitor satisfaction, from admission through to departure. Develop a strong technical knowledge of the exhibits, their operation and how to trouble-shoot technical issues. Contribution to the development and evolution of the Exhibits across the Visitor Attraction. Build relationships with your colleagues in other department Assist in the further development of improved operating procedures within the exhibits. Assist in developing H&S and Emergency procedures across the VA department.
